[发明专利]一种多通道回声滤除方法、滤除装置和可读存储介质有效
申请号: | 202010601733.6 | 申请日: | 2020-06-29 |
公开(公告)号: | CN111726464B | 公开(公告)日: | 2021-04-20 |
发明(设计)人: | 荣赶丁;何颖洋 | 申请(专利权)人: | 珠海全志科技股份有限公司 |
主分类号: | H04M9/08 | 分类号: | H04M9/08;G10L21/0208;G10L21/0216 |
代理公司: | 珠海智专专利商标代理有限公司 44262 | 代理人: | 黄国豪 |
地址: | 519080 广东省*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 通道 回声 方法 装置 可读 存储 介质 | ||
1.一种多通道回声滤除方法,其特征在于,包括:
获取第一通道的第一音频数据和第二通道的第二音频数据,分别对所述第一音频数据和所述第二音频数据重采样,继而得出第一时域数据和第二时域数据;
对所述第一时域数据和所述第二时域数据利用镜像原理处理得出第一反转时域数据和第二反转时域数据;
根据重采样率和初始采样率的比值R大于1时,计算并得出第一MIDFT矩阵;
根据重采样率和初始采样率的比值R小于1时,计算并得出第二MIDFT矩阵;
计算DFT矩阵;
将所述第一MIDFT矩阵和所述DFT矩阵进行叠加并相乘,继而得出
将所述第二MIDFT矩阵和所述DFT矩阵进行叠加并相乘,继而得出
根据所述第一时域数据和计算得出P1,根据所述第二时域数据和计算得出P2;
P1相乘所述第一反转时域数据得出第一重采样时域信号;
P2相乘所述第二反转时域数据得出第二重采样时域信号;
对所述第一重采样时域信号和所述第二重采样时域信号进行低频相位处理;
接收声音信号,所述声音信号包括语音信号和回声信号,根据经过低频相位处理后的第一重采样时域信号和第二重采样时域信号对所述回声信号进行滤除,并输出回声滤除后的声音信号。
2.根据权利要求1所述的回声滤除方法,其特征在于:
所述第一时域数据为xl,2N=[xl[-N],...xl[0],...xl[N-1]]T,l为左声道的音频数据,N为一帧数据的长度,T为混响时间;
所述第二时域数据为xr,2N=[xr[-N],...xr[0],...xr[N-1]]T,r为右 声道的音频数据。
3.根据权利要求2所述的回声滤除方法,其特征在于:
第一反转时域数据为
第二反转时域数据为
其中表示反转。
4.根据权利要求3所述的回声滤除方法,其特征在于:
MIDFT矩阵为:
5.根据权利要求4所述的回声滤除方法,其特征在于:
所述DFT矩阵为:
[F]k+1,n+1=e-j2πkn/4N,k,n∈[0,4N-1]。
6.根据权利要求1至5任一项所述的回声滤除方法,其特征在于:
对所述第一重采样时域信号和所述第二重采样时域信号进行低频相位处理的步骤包括:
对经过低频相位处理后的第一重采样时域信号和第二重采样时域信号进行FFT转换,并得出第一频域信号和第二频域信号;
对所述第一频域信号和所述第二频域信号分别提取第一相位值和第二相位值,通过所述第一相位值减去所述第二相位值得出相位差值;
根据所述相位差值,对所述第一相位值和所述第二相位值进行相位调整;
根据相位调整后的第一相位值将所述第一频域信号时频逆转换,得出第一输出时域信号;
根据相位调整后的第二相位值将所述第二频域信号时频逆转换,得出第二输出时域信号;
根据所述第一输出时域信号和所述第二输出时域信号进行滤除,并输出回声滤除后的声音信号。
7.一种多通道回声滤除装置,包括处理器,所述处理器用于执行存储器中存储的计算机程序时实现如权利要求1至6中任意一项所述滤除方法的步骤。
8.一种可读存储介质,其上存储有计算机程序,其特征在于:所述计算机程序被处理器执行时实现如权利要求1至6中任意一项所述滤除方法的步骤。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于珠海全志科技股份有限公司,未经珠海全志科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010601733.6/1.html,转载请声明来源钻瓜专利网。